A 27-year-old man identified as Ubakpororo Kelvin has been arrested by the Delta State Police Command following the brutal killing of his girlfriend, Excel Ukeredi Peace, who was also the mother of his two children. The tragic incident occurred on June 26, 2025.

Kelvin had gone into hiding after the crime, prompting a manhunt. He was eventually captured and taken into custody, where he reportedly confessed to the killing in a video released by police authorities.

According to the police, Kelvin admitted that the confrontation with Peace escalated after he accused her of engaging in sex work. During the heated exchange, he claimed she picked up a knife. Kelvin, who said he was under the influence of tramadol and a strong form of cannabis known as “loud,” stated that he reacted violently, striking her three times on the forehead with a hammer.

Investigations also revealed that the suspect works as a farmer and engages in internet-related fraud.

The case has sparked outrage, with many calling for justice and expressing concern about rising cases of domestic violence, drug abuse, and criminal behavior in the region. Authorities are expected to press formal charges as investigations continue.
